About Surendranagar District

Surendranagar is a district in Gujarat,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Surendranagar was 1,756,268 with a growth rate of 15.91%. Surendranagar covers 10,423 Km2 area. Sex ratio of Surendranagar's population is 930 females for every 1000 males, while child sex ratio is 896 females out of 1000 males.

Urban/Rural Population of Surendranagar

DESCRIPTION VALUE DESCRIPTION VALUE
Urban Population 496,916 Rural Population 1,259,352
Urban Population (%) 28.29 Rural Population (%) 71.71
Urban male Population 260,442 Rural Male Population 649,475
Urban Female Population 236,474 Rural Female Population 609,877
Urban Sex Ratio 908 Rural Sex Ratio 939

Surendranagar urban population is 496,916 (28.29% of the total), while the rural population is 1,259,352 (71.71% of the total). The urban population growth rate is significantly higher at % compared to the rural growth rate of %.

Among the urban population 260,442 are males, and 236,474 are females, resulting in an urban sex ratio of 908 females per 1000 males. In the rural population 649,475 are males and 609,877 are females, resulting in an rural sex ratio of 939 females per 1000 males.

Literacy data of Surendranagar

DESCRIPTION VALUE DESCRIPTION VALUE
Total Literate 1,093,626 Literacy (%) 72.13
Male Literate 643,221 Male Literacy (%) 82.11
Female Literate 450,405 Female Literacy (%) 61.45
Urban Literate 362,923 Rural Literate 730,703
Urban Male Literates 205,564 Urban Male Literacy (%) 89.21
Rural Male Literates 437,657 Rural Male Literacy (%) 79.15
Urban Female Literates 157,359 Urban Female Literacy (%) 74.74
Rural Female Literates 293,046 Rural Female Literacy (%) 56.10

The literacy data of Surendranagar highlights a total literacy rate stands at 72.13% with 1,093,626 literate individuals. Male literacy is 82.11% while female literacy is lower at 61.45% among them, 643,221 males and 450,405 females are literate, highlighting a gender gap.

Urban areas show higher literacy rate with 362,923 people being literate, with men at 89.21% and female at 74.74%, compared to rural areas whereas 730,703 people are literate, with male at 79.15% and female at 56.10%. Highlights a gap between urban and rural literacy rates.

Religion Wise Data of Surendranagar

DESCRIPTION VALUE DESCRIPTION VALUE
Hindu 1,620,282 Hindu (%) 92.26
Muslim 109,681 Muslim (%) 6.25
Sikh 512 Sikh (%) 0.03
Christian 1,419 Christian (%) 0.08
Jain 22,992 Jain (%) 1.31
Buddhist 312 Buddhist (%) 0.02
Other 128 Other (%) 0.01
Not Avaiable 942 Not Avaiable (%) 0.05

Surendranagar population is mostly hindu (92.26%) with a total 1,620,282 people. Muslim(6.25%) with a total 109,681 people. Sikh are (0.03%) with a total 512 people. Smaller communities include Christian (0.08% with 1,419 people). Jain (1.31% with 22,992 people) Buddhist (0.02% with 312 people) and Other (0.01% with 128 people). Around (0.05% with 942 people) did not specify their religion.
